A TERRACE OVERLOOKING
THE ITRIA VALLEY

The name Locorotondo (namely Round Place) refers to the circular shape of the old town centre, a unique monument overlooking the Itria Valley that fascinates with its white little houses, paved alleys and flowered balconies.

About a thousand years ago, the local farmers built up the typical cummerse, houses with sloping roofs that are also found at Masseria Grieco. Locorotondo is part of the itinerary of the Wine Routes in Apulia that crosses the Itria Valley and is home to one of the most promising white wines of Apulia: Locorotondo DOC.
